Pros of Moving
- + $19K higher median salary
- + Better student-teacher ratios
Cons of Moving
- - 19% higher cost of living
- - $1056/mo more expensive rent (2BR)
- - Higher violent crime rate
- - More expensive childcare
- - More environmental violations
